Ridgmont to Amberley by train

Considering a train trip from Ridgmont to Amberley? The journey typically lasts around 4hrs 1 mins and spans about 78 miles (125 kilometres). With approximately 17 trains running each day, you're spoiled for choice when scheduling your travel. By booking your tickets in advance, you could secure fares starting from just £44.40, making it a budget-friendly option for smart travelers.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Ridgmont to Amberley start from £44.40 one way, or £44.50 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Ridgmont to Amberley are available for £56.50 one way, or £81.40 return

Facilities at Ridgmont Station

Ridgmont Station, while quaint, is equipped with a range of facilities to ensure a comfortable journey. Although it lacks a ticket office, ticket machines, and SMART card options, travelers won't be completely stranded. An induction loop is available for those who require it, and customer announcements provide vital travel updates. For any additional assistance, a help point is conveniently located at the station. However, do take note that there is no staff help available on site.

While facilities like waiting rooms with seating areas are accessible during certain hours, the station lacks some amenities. For instance, there are no accessible toilets or baby-changing facilities. On a brighter note, a visit to Ridgmont is not complete without a stop at the Ridgmont Station Tea Rooms, open from Tuesday through Sunday. Also explore the gift shop at the Heritage Centre, open from Easter to October. You'll find charming momentos and local treasures worth taking home. Plus, parking is free, although spaces are limited.

Accessibility and Support at Ridgmont

Travelers with accessibility needs will find Ridgmont Station partially accommodating. Classified as a step-free access category B1 station, all platforms are step-free although these may require using long or steep ramps. Assistance for boarding is readily available upon prior arrangement as the station works closely with Passenger Assist. Unfortunately, accessible parking spaces and accessible toilets are not provided at this station.

Facilities at Amberley Train Station

Amberley Station might be on the smaller side, but it efficiently caters to the needs of its passengers. While the station lacks a formal ticket office, passengers can conveniently purchase and collect train tickets from automated ticket machines. These machines are accessible and support the use of Disabled Persons Railcard discounts, ensuring inclusivity for all travelers.

Passengers requiring assistance are welcome to take advantage of the station's help points, though there are no dedicated staff on site. The station provides on-platform customer help points equipped to offer comprehensive assistance, ensuring travelers get the support they need.

This station also ensures a degree of accessibility with step-free access available to platform 2 (towards the coast), while platform 1 (towards London) requires the use of steps. For travelers who require a ramp to board trains, assistance can be sought either at the station or directly from onboard staff.

Making the Most of Your Visit

Amberley Station is surrounded by the serene beauty of the South Downs, just a short distance from the Amberley Museum and Heritage Centre, which celebrates the industrial history of the area with fascinating exhibits suitable for all ages. It's a perfect day out for anyone with an interest in the past.

If you're cycling through the area, check out the station's bicycle storage area with stands available, though they aren't sheltered. If parking is necessary, rest assured with 26 free parking spaces at the station, managed by APCOA Parking UK.
